Title:Attorney Charles Erbstein and John Whitman, standing in a room, Erbstein touching the back of his head with his right handDescription:Three-quarter length group portrait of Charles E. Erbstein, an attorney, standing with John L. Whitman, Superintendent of Prisons, in front of a light-colored wall in a room in Chicago, Illinois. Erbstein and Whitman are both holding the same piece of paper.
